Business school information

  • HKUST Business School was established in 1991 and is one of the most respected business schools in Asia. It has achieved global recognition in a very short period of time, along with a variety of prestigious academic rankings. It offers a full range of programs, world-class faculty, and a diverse student body.
  • HKUST has left its mark in life science, engineering, business education, humanities, social science, and much more. The university has become a powerhouse in tertiary education, constantly striving toward innovation and pushing the limits to make a difference in the world.

Study in Hong Kong

  • Hong Kong is a dynamic cosmopolitan city located to the southeast of mainland China. Despite its small territory, it is in the top 10 of the world’s largest trading economies. Hong Kong is also a major service economy, with particularly strong links to mainland China and the rest of the Asia-Pacific region.
  • As China’s gateway to the world, Hong Kong is a global hub that bridges business, finance, and innovation.
  • English is widely spoken, making this city easily accessible to international students.

Program description

The Kellogg-HKUST Executive MBA program is a unique partnership between the Kellogg School of Management at Northwestern University and the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ology.

The renowned program brings together senior executives from across the world to instill a new way of thinking and embrace unique challenges. The program equips students with the skills needed to make strategic business decisions to transform both their professional business environment and their personal life.

At the Kellogg-HKUST Executive MBA (KHEMBA) program you will embark on an intellectually stimulating journey, discover remarkable opportunities and build enduring connections with fellow students and faculty. You will be part of a truly global network and have access to a world class faculty spanning 6 continents that gives you Western perspective with Asian insight.

Admission requirements

Language Test:

TOEFL 80

(minimum)

IELTS 6

(minimum)

Age (Avg):

42

Experience (Min/Avg):

10/18

Other:

* Possess a bachelor’s degree from a recognized university or an approved institution, or possess recognized professional qualifications equivalent to a degree;

* Have company sponsorship and support;

* Results of the International English Language Testing System (IELTS) or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L) for applicants who were educated at institutions where the primary language of instruction was not English and whose native language is not English.
